goodthts Posted March 4, 2010 Report Share Posted March 4, 2010 Our own ZipsNation member, scottditzen, has a movie in the Cleveland International Film Festival this year. The movie, Out of Place, explores the dedicated group of NE Ohio surfers that ride Lake Erie’s waves.
